What did people expect to read in papers and on the Internet or watch on TV on World Consumer Rights Day yesterday?
Well, it's obvious - typical cases of how consumer rights are violated, advice from experts about how consumers should protect themselves, and the hollow promises of manufacturers and service providers about quality products and services.
Consumers feel cheated when told butchers have added water to the meat they eat, and merchants or manufacturers restless when blacklists of problematic products and companies are published.
